Product Description
As soon as the temperature of the collector exceeds the storage tank temperature, the controller activates the circulation pump and the heat medium liquid transports the heat, taken up at the collector, into the hot water storage tank.
Conventional heating systems ensure a required after-heating within the storage. Because of the easy integration into building techniques and an average life expectation of more than 25 years, solar systems are an ideal complement to modern heating technology
Cib differential temperature controllers are used in solar, heating and heat pump systems to initiate switching processes depending on thermal, hydraulic and environmental conditions.
In general, the controller monitors the determined temperature differences of the sensors and compares them to the given set temperature differences. The controller is switched on if the adjusted temperature difference is exceeded. The system is controlled by one or more relays. Pumps or electric valves may be connected to these relays.

KTD controller:
- input: 3 temperature sensors; 1 pressure sensor to measure water volume;
- output: 3 outputs @ 12vdc
- LCD display
- with 485 connector
KTD-plus controller
- input: 4 temperature sensors; 1 pressure sensor to measure water volume; 1 sensor to measure piping pressure
- output:
1 output @10a, 220vac (electric booster)
1 output @ 5a, 220vac
2 outputs @ 3a, 220vac (pump)
2 outputs @ 1a, 220vac
- LCD display
- with 485 connector
KTD-PRO controller
- input: 5 temperature sensors; 1 pressure sensor to measure water volume;
- output:
1 output @16a, 220vac (electric booster)
1 output @ 10a, 220vac
4 outputs @ 5a, 220vac
- LCD display
- with 485 connector
KYT-1 controller
- input power: 220vac
- input: 3 temperature sensors; 1 pressure sensor to measure water volume;
- output: 4 outputs @10a, 220vac
- temperature sensors: Mf53 3.3kohm @ 25c
- LED display
KYT-2 controller
- input power: 220vac
- input: 5 temperature sensors; 2 pressure sensor to measure water volume; 1 sensor to measure piping pressure
- output: 8 outputs @10a, 220vac
- temperature sensors: Mf53 thermistor 3.3k ohm@25
- touch screen display
- remote monitor with 485 connector optional.
